
Solid Viscoelastic Damping
Solid Viscoelastic dampers were the first damping system used to solve structural vibration problems, including mitigation of wind and earthquake, floor and stair vibrations amongst other types of dynamic loads. When Viscoelastic material is deformed, there is an instantaneous stiffness and damping restoring force. Because solid Viscoelastic damping material is connected directly to the vibrating structure it is activated instantaneously, adding damping and stiffness for all vibration amplitudes and types, from frequent wind storms that can cause occupant discomfort through maximum credible earthquakes that can damage building structures.
